I am currently in the process of fighting to keep my previous time in rank after recently re enrolling.
Here is what happened.... I was re enrolled in March 2014 after being out of the military for nearly 5 years (at that time I had been an Lt for 2yrs). I kept my rank and all my training was credited as well as my IPC for pay. I was told when I signed the paper work that I would keep my time in rank and therefore not have to redo 3 yrs as an Lt. Currently my file is being reviewed at brigade on this matter.
Here are the questions then:
Is anyone aware of a regulation that states that time in rank must be continuous?
I have looked through some of the QR&O's and some of the DAOD but haven't found anything pertaining to this kind of situation, any other places I should be looking?
